| An early 1950s electric gramophone record player made in England, featuring an electric motor and horn gramophone transducer (acoustic, no speaker). The case is excellently illustrated with 1950s colourful dancing teenagers and musical instruments, sort of American Bandstand style. The transducer has a blue plastic head and blue painted horn, and the turntable is red, with traces of the original red felt. It has an applied SKS ELECTRONICS sticker applied to the front. This gramophone is in very good condition, with no repairs or damage other than the following: the motor hums but will not turn and could use rebuilding and lubrication; the red felt liner is worn off the turntable; there is some scratching on the top graphic from travel of the needle; there is some paint loss to the metal horn; the graphics are a bit soiled and could use a cleaning.
